F5 patches critical BIG-IP ADC remote code execution vulnerability

F5 patches critical BIG-IP ADC remote code execution vulnerability

July 3, 2020 Greg Swiecicki

“F5 Networks (F5) patched a critical remote code execution (RCE) vulnerability found in undisclosed pages of Traffic Management User Interface (TMUI) of the BIG-IP application delivery controller (ADC).”
